ATTENTION: Before replacing a fuse, turn off the switch of such a
circuit.
A burn-out fuse can be visually identified by its internal broken filament.
The fuse should be replaced only after you find out why it has burned out
(overcharge, shor t circuit, etc). Replace it with an original one of equal
capacity.
Lights Replacement
When replacing a lamp, turn off the switch of its respective circuit.
Avoid touching the lamp bulb with your hands. Sweaty or oily hands can cause
stains; when evaporating, they may darken the lens.
Stained lamps may be cleaned with a lint-free alcohol-soaked rag.
The new lamps to be used for replacing should feature the same characteristics
and capacities as the replaced ones.
To replace the headlight lamps, observe the following:
• External side lamps: low-beam headllamps.
• Internal side lamps: hight-beam headlamps.
The lamps replacement is performed accessing the respective compartments on
the back-ends of the headlights.
• After opening of the compartment (front cover plate), remove the socket/lamp
assembly and replace the burned-out lamp carefully, avoiding contact of its bulb
with your skin.
• Reinstall the assembly into the headlight receptacle in the correct position.
• Check if the lamp is well fixed to avoid water ingress.
MULTIFUNCTIONAL SWITCH
Multifunctional switch is located
on the left side of the driver. It
comprises signalizing, lightening
and windshield wiper controls
incorpotated in one switch only.
Turning Movement
This movement activates rateably the windshield wiper.
Position A – Wiper is switched off
Position B- Wiper operates at intermittent speed
Position C – Wiper operates at a slow speed
Position D – Wiper operates at a high speed
